Veronica Lechuga was born on the 7th of May in 1983 to parents Maria Elena and Jesus Lechuga in the north side of Denver, Colorado. Vero was a dancer, a traveler, a hard worker, and a loving mother to Angel, Sara, and Viviana Vieyra. We announce with sorrowful hearts her death on the 12th of April 2025. Vero had a big, infectious smile with a heart of gold, which will be missed until the last person who saw her smile, felt her warm touch, breathed her sweet smell, and tasted her delicious meals leaves this earth. Rest in peace as you wait for us, mamita.
